```## Getting Started
If you want to get started locally, you can clone the project, install the dependencies and run the dev command!
```
git clone https://github.com/netlify-templates/solid-quickstart.git
cd solid-quickstart
npm install
npm run dev
# or start the server and open the app in a new browser tab
npm run dev -- --open
```## Building
Solid apps are built with _adapters_, which optimise your project for deployment to different environments.
By default, `npm run build` will generate a Node app that you can run with `npm start`. To use a different adapter, add it to the `devDependencies` in `package.json` and specify in your `vite.config.js`.
## Deploying using the Netlify CLI
- Install the Netlify CLI globally `npm install netlify-cli -g`
- Run `npm run build`- Then use the `netlify deploy` for a deploy preview link or `netlify deploy --prod` to deploy to production
Here are a few other ways you can deploy this template:
- Use the Netlify CLI's create from template command `netlify sites:create-template solid-quickstart` which will create a repo, Netlify project, and deploy it
- If you want to utilize continuous deployment through GitHub webhooks, run the Netlify command `netlify init` to create a new project based on your repo or `netlify link` to connect your repo to an existing projectHope this template helps :) Happy coding 👩🏻💻!
